Intelligent NR
Overview
Intelligent NR (Intelligent Noise Reduction) is an advanced image processing technology developed by Canon for its CXDI series of digital radiography (DR) devices. Utilizing proprietary deep learning AI, Intelligent NR significantly reduces image graininess in X-ray images by up to 50% compared to conventional noise reduction methods. This innovation allows for the acquisition of high-quality diagnostic images with lower patient radiation doses, addressing a critical concern in medical imaging, especially for sensitive populations like pediatric patients.
The technology is trained on an extensive database of approximately 3,000 clinical X-ray images, enabling it to efficiently remove unnecessary noise while preserving essential image signals and fine anatomical details. Intelligent NR is a software component of the CXDI Control Software (v. 3.10 and above) and is compatible with various Canon CXDI flat panel detectors. It aims to support better-quality diagnoses and optimize the diagnostic environment by providing clearer images even in inherently noisy conditions.

What Physicians Need to Know
Leverage Intelligent NR to optimize radiation dose protocols, especially for pediatric and dose-sensitive patients, as it allows for significant dose reduction (up to 50%) while maintaining diagnostic image quality. Expect clearer, less grainy images that can enhance diagnostic confidence and potentially reduce the need for repeat examinations. Be aware that the tool is specifically for DR/X-ray and integrates seamlessly into the existing Canon DR workflow.
Intelligent NR is a software option that integrates with Canon's CXDI Control Software (v. 3.10 and above) and is compatible with specific Canon CXDI flat panel detectors. It operates on a connected PC, processing images before display, and is designed to work within the established DR imaging chain, which typically interfaces with PACS for image archival and review. Adding the option to existing systems may require additional computer hardware.

| FDA Status |
1 AI-estimated Intelligent NR received FDA 510(k) clearance (K212269) on September 17, 2021, as a component of Canon's CXDI Control Software for digital radiography devices, intended to reduce noise in X-ray images. |

What the Web Says
Intelligent NR (Noise Reduction) is an AI-powered image processing option, primarily from Canon Medical Systems, designed to reduce noise in diagnostic images while preserving anatomical detail. It utilizes machine learning and deep learning with existing clinical image databases to create neural networks for noise reduction. Physicians and studies indicate that it significantly improves image quality, particularly in pediatric radiography, and has the potential for radiation dose reduction.
Overall: PositiveStrengths
- High-quality diagnostic images with reduced noise.
- No noticeable loss of anatomical detail.
- Potential for radiation dose reduction, especially in pediatric patients.
- Improved image quality in pediatric and neonatal chest and abdominal radiography.
- Superior to conventional noise reduction methods.
- Maintains contrast and spatial resolution.
Limitations
- Only available on specific Canon systems (NE 3.10 and higher; x10).
- Performance in the pediatric population was initially unclear, requiring further study.
- Some studies have limitations, such as small sample sizes or single-location device evaluations.
- AI software should be implemented carefully to ensure desired image quality without loss of diagnostic information or artifacts.
